Hi Zulufields,

Your questions haven't been asked but that's probably because the answer is quite difficult.. I'll try to answer all of them:

- Expected costs of hosting per share
We are looking at different options in Holland and Norway. We don't know what the costs of hosting at KNC yet. It looks like hosting a single miner will cost around € 400,- euro a month (this is a really rough estimate). Mainly because racks usually have 32Amps and one miner uses almost 5 Amps. It mainly depends on final power usage numbers; heat and size since those numbers aren't 100% sure yet.

- hardware failure prediction estimate
No we don't. Although we believe that it will be possible to replace parts of the device if broken. This is one of the reasons why we want to have as much miners as possible to spread risk. It's probably possible to tune the machines; we will do that only if we know for sure it doesn't shorten lifespan.

- returns per share over next 24 months
This is the most difficult question. At current difficulty one Jupiter will mine 11.2793 BTC a day (Look here for calculations http://www.bitcoinx.com/profit/). That means break even within a week. However there's no way to tell what the difficulty is going to be when we get the miners. Last few times difficulty went up between 10 and 20% per ~two weeks (http://bitcoin.sipa.be/). With 15% per two weeks difficulty will be around 300% of what it is now so payout will be 3.7768 BTC a day which means a break-even of 18 days. Look at the numbers mentioned above and play a bit with the numbers.. Realise yourself though that these miners themselves will have a huge impact on the difficulty.
